Mote Marine Laboratory and Aquarium
Image Source: Flickr
An aquarium with exhibits and activities for every age group. Help feed seahorses or sharks or take a guided kayak tour. Check the website before you go, for reservation, age, or other requirements.
- Location: 1600 Ken Thompson Pkwy., Sarasota, Florida, 34236.
- Hours: 10 a.m. to 5 p.m., year-round.
- Admission: Adult (13 and older), $22. Youth (aged 3-12), $16. Children 2 and under, free.
Ringling Circus Museum
Six stops in one beautiful location! This location includes The Tibbals Learning Center, Museum of Art, Ca’d’Zan, Historic Asolo Theater, Bayfront Gardens, and the Original Circus Museum showcase the history of the circus. Kids will love the miniature circus, animals, and seeing how many siblings can fit in a clown car.
Parents will love the art and beauty of The Museum of Art and the historic mansion, Ca’d’Zan.
- Location: 5401 Bay Shore Rd, Sarasota, Florida, 34243
- Hours: 10: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m. daily. Closed on Thanksgiving, Christmas, and New Year’s Day.
- Admission: adult, $25 (a three-day pass is $35). Children 6-17, $5 (a three-day pass is $10). Children 5 and under, free.
Coquina Beach
Image Source: Wikipedia
No visit to Longboat Key is complete without a day at the beach. Family-friendly Coquina Beach has everything you need, including picnic tables, grills, concessions, changing rooms, and more. Not to mention the soft white sand, shallow water, shells, and occasionally dolphins. And, if one day isn’t enough, there are family-friendly accommodations nearby.
- Location: 1800 Gulf Dr, Longboat Key, Florida, 34217
- Hours: Sunrise to sunset
- Admission: Free
Myakka River State Park
For the outdoorsy, Myakka River State Park is a slice of heaven. Offering lake tours, kayaking, hiking, freshwater fishing, and even a treetop canopy walkway, Myakka River State Park lets you experience the natural beauty of Florida. Visit for the day, or stay and play at the campgrounds, primitive campsites, or log cabins.
- Location: 13208 State Rd 72, Sarasota, Florida, 34241
- Hours: 8 a.m. to sunset
- Admission: $2 – $6 per person or vehicle
Manatee Viewing Center
Image Source: Maxpixel
The Manatee Viewing Center is part of the Apollo Beach Big Bend Power Station. The two have coexisted since the manatees discovered the warm waters around the plant. Learn how nature and technology cohabitate here, then climb the 50-foot observation tower and see for yourself.
- Location: 6990 Dickman Rd, Apollo Beach, Florida, 33572
- Hours: 10 a.m. to 5 p.m. daily, Nov. 1 through April 15. Closed on Thanksgiving, Christmas Eve, Christmas Day, and Easter.
- Admission: Free
